6.11.6 Reference Point
Approach -
Examples
One limit switch serves at the same time as reference point switch.
Terminal X2A.14 = limit switch right (di.19 = 32)
Terminal X2A.15 = limit switch left + reference point switch (di.20 = 67108920)
Terminal X2A.10 = start reference point approach (di.11 = 134217728)
Reference speed = -100 rpm with counter-clockwise rotation (PS.21 = -100)
Position after reference point approach
(independent from PS.14 Bit 3)
